Back Porch Files - June 14th: Parade, Protest, Political Terrorism
June 14th, 2025 was a day of stark contrasts in America. In D.C., a lackluster military parade with more fanfare than substance. Across the country, 13 million people flooded the streets for the largest single-day protest in U.S. history — the “No Kings” march. But amid the chants and chaos came tragedy: a targeted political assassination in Minnesota that claimed the lives of State Rep. Melissa Hortman and her husband, and left two more victims fighting for theirs. In this episode, we unpack the spectacle, the uprising, and the violence — and we call out the right-wing disinformation machine that tried to rewrite it all before the blood was even dry. June 14th wasn’t just another day on the calendar. It was a crossroads. Let’s talk about how we got here — and where we go next.
